The Go Pro Hero 3 comes in three editions, white, silver and black giving customers on a budget a wider choice of camera. I already own the Go Pro Hero, HD Hero 2 and accessories like the Wi-Fi BacPac, iPhone app etc. Why? Because I love this camera and all that is possible with it! Here are the specs for the 3 Go Pro Hero 3 cameras:White Editioncheck Video Resolution: 1080p 30fps, 960p 30fps and 720p 60fpscheck Camera Stills: 5mp/3fps Burstcheck Wi-Fi: Built Incheck Wi-Fi Remote and App Compatible Silver Editioncheck Video Resolution: 1080p 30fps, 960p 48fps and 720p 60fpscheck Camera Stills: 11mp/10fps Burstcheck Wi-Fi: Built Incheck Wi-Fi Remote and App CompatibleBlack Editioncheck Video: 4kp 12fps, 2.7kp 30fpscheck Video Resolution: 1440p 48fps, 1080p 60fps and 720p 120fpscheck Camera Stills: 12mp/30fps Burstcheck Wi-Fi: Built Incheck Wi-Fi Remote Included and App Compatiblecheck Better Low Light PerformanceWhat's New?The Go Pro Hero 3 is stated as being 30% smaller, 25% lighter and 2x more powerful than its predecessor. Still waterproof to 60m but with seriously ramped up specs. I will no doubt buy the Black Edition above too for an extra angle.What people need to realise is that there is no way around this problem. Go Pro and other manufacturers cannot say when a new product is on the cards. They can't remove the old product from the shelves as sales would plummet which is retail suicide.People need to be patientIf you decide you want a new camera, look to see when the previous one was released. Check out the release dates and trends for previous models too. Until the point where a new model is released, and if you simply need a camera in the meantime, rent one!I have learned my lesson the hard way and it can be a tough (and expensive) pill to swallow.
